Optical Noninvasive Temperature Measurement of Molten Melts in Metallurgical Process: A Review

摘要
High-temperature melts, including molten metals and molten melts, are common substances in the pyrometallurgical process. Temperature is one of the most concerned and important physical properties of melts. Maintaining a melt’s molten state means huge energy consumption. Moreover, the temporary storage, transfer, and subsequent processing of them are usually accompanied by considerable risks. Thus, real-time temperature measurement of the melt is one of the core requirements. Due to the high corrosiveness of molten phases, invasive temperature measurement is no longer applicable or even could not deploy in high-temperature melts. Therefore, optical temperature measurement technology has been brought into prime focus. This paper provides a review of the academic improvement involved and commercial technology employed in each optical temperature measurement device. Recent progress and trends are investigated in both radiation thermometers and computer vision-based pyrometers. The measurement principle and characteristics of each device are discussed in detail. The optimization of accuracy is emphasized based on radiation thermometers, while the reasons for a few computer vision-based pyrometers are mentioned. In addition, a new temperature diagnosis technology that combines computer vision and artificial intelligence has received widespread attention and applications in recent years. Future developments are briefly introduced to provide some insight into which direction the development and application of temperature measurement technologies are likely to develop.
